Its on its way... FINALLY!
Alright well i just completed my order finally, but i need to know the little extra things i need to buy to make it all happen now this is what i ordered:
Injen cold air Skunk2 70mm Vibrant header with HFC P2R throttle body spacer (and i know suspension doesnt go here but im adding it anyway) Eibach ProKit Skunk2 rear camber arms so what do i need, flex radiator hose, do i need anything for the header exhaust connection or will it fit just fine? and for the header do i NEEED a defouler or can i go without, and where would i got about getting one, are they easy to find local? pics when i get it together! |

You're probably going to need an extra gasket as the Vibrant header (w/ HFC) does not come with one. I ordered the Vibrant header w/ HFC with the vibrant exhaust and had to get another gasket and set of fasteners. I just ordered em from SCtuned once I found out.

You should just reuse the stock engine gasket, the Skunk will come with one for the exhaust, as well as bolts for the exhaust/header.
I've got the Vibrant/Skunk combo as well, and I would definitely get the Weapon R angled defouler. CELs vary with the person. Me, I drove 300 (maybe) miles without one, then got a CEL EVERY 19 miles. After installing the defouler, I've been 2000+ miles with no CEL, and that's more than enough to pass emmissions testing. The only other thing I would add to your list might be some Ingalls camber bolts for the front. You can usually fing them for $20 on Ebay. |

I don't know how good of an idea it would be to reuse the gaskets. As with the having/not having a defouler, I'd much rather know that all my parts are functioning safely and to the best of their ability. This is why I bought both the defouler and new gasket/fasteners. The gasket and fasteners you can get pretty cheap probably, but I shelled out close to or around $20 (because where I got them, i had to by 2 sets of fasteners...I needed 3 and they were sold in sets of 2...and shipping costs). It's your call, but I'd rather make the investment to KNOW everything will be good.
